Exploring RBC Express Online Banking

RBC Express is a corporate online banking tool from the Royal Bank of Canada (RBC). It is tailored for scaling businesses that require comprehensive financial management tools.

It goes far beyond the features of standard online banking by providing multi-user access, real-time insights, and multi-level authorizations.

The Benefit of Multi-User Access

Delegating banking tasks is more than just reducing workload; it’s about creating a secure operational environment. RBC Express allows for role-based access, supporting:

1. Role-Based Access Control (RBAC)
You can grant each team member specific roles. For instance, your HR manager can run salaries, while your accounting team can manage invoices, and executives can authorize transfers.

2. Multi-Level Approvals
Large transactions can be managed through approval hierarchies, ensuring no one person can authorize critical actions.

3.Real-Time Monitoring and Audit Trails
All user actions are logged in real-time. If something goes wrong, you can trace who did what and when.

4. Improved Productivity
By assigning roles, team members can concentrate on their core functions, reducing delays and improving efficiency.

Core RBC Express Features for Delegation

RBC Express offers several tools that make delegation seamless:

A. User Management Tools
You can create new users, modify roles, restrict access, and remove accounts when needed.

B. Permission-Based Services
Configure user access for:
- Recurring Charges
- International Transactions
- Employee Payments
- Government Filings

C. Custom Reporting and Dashboards
View and filter reports by:
- Transaction Type
- Approval Status
- Financial Trends

D. Mobile Access with RBC Express App
The rbc express mobile version lets authorized users handle approvals, view balances, and receive alerts from anywhere.

Maintaining Security with Delegation

RBC Express is built with enterprise-level security protocols:

i. Two-Factor Authentication (copyright)
Users are required to verify identity using a second layer for login.

ii. SSL Encryption
All data is protected with 256-bit SSL protocols.

iii. Session Timeouts
Automatic logout blocks unauthorized access in case of inactivity.

iv. IP Restrictions
You can control access based on IP or geographic country.

Use Case Examples

1. Retail Chain
Regional managers handle local payments; finance department approves them; head office oversees.

2.Construction Company
Site managers initiate procurement payments; central finance approves transactions.

3. Non-Profit Organization
Program directors track expenses, while board members approve fund disbursement.
